Transaction 62ce515c7073fb62d5076d104fdd944a381eb192a0069a18139b9e8d44919eaf

1 Input
2 Outputs
  • 62ce515c7073fb62d5076d104fdd944a381eb192a0069a18139b9e8d44919eaf:0
  • value  2205258
    address  3LsgVRr7xo2m5jv7qNVcELRo61whzB8oeU
  • 62ce515c7073fb62d5076d104fdd944a381eb192a0069a18139b9e8d44919eaf:1
  • value  10274129
    address  bc1qmyql0nhe560trdxpnlycn5fqhnndtp45p55sc7